You can go to Audio Quality and choose the needed output quality. The higher the audio quality, the larger the ripped music files will be. For example, you can change the output path by clicking on Change button, or select the details you want to include via File Name, such as Artist, Album, Track number, Song title and so forth.

Moreover, you can choose to rip CD automatically, eject the CD disc after ripping, etc. After you adjust the settings, click on Apply and then OK.
